Why I Stopped Attending Church – Nigerian Singer, Chike Opens Up (Video)

In an interview with VJ Adams, he revealed that running into someone from his past at a church made him feel uncomfortable, bringing back memories that made attending services difficult.
The singer said he stayed only briefly before deciding to leave.
Chike made it clear that stepping away from church does not mean he lost his belief in God.
He recalled a time early in his career when he prayed for guidance while living in Primewater Gardens with his girlfriend, seeking help during a period when he felt alone and uncertain about his future.
He also mentioned a strange experience shortly after releasing his first album when he accidentally consumed a strong edible and felt disoriented for several days.
Despite such moments, Chike said he learned the importance of living rightly and treating others well, regardless of whether he follows church rituals.
He said, “The person leading the praise and worship and I had history. I was having flashbacks, and I felt out of place. I stayed only a week before leaving.
“It’s not because I don’t believe in God. I do.
“I just prayed, ‘God, I don’t have anybody. I don’t have anything. Just help me.
“A few days after my album release, I accidentally consumed something strong and didn’t even know where I was.
“Church is not for me. There are things I enjoy that I wouldn’t be able to do there.
“What matters most is doing right by people. Being Christian doesn’t mean you have to live in a certain way. Doing good for others is what counts.”

BREAKING NEWS: Newly Elected President of AGN, Abubakar Yakubu Arrested in Lagos – FULL DETAILS

Preliminary reports indicate that the crash resulted in the death of an individual.
Yakubu has been taken into police custody at the Barracks Police Station in Surulere, where investigations into the circumstances surrounding the accident are ongoing.
Authorities are yet to issue an official statement on the cause of the crash or the progress of the investigation.
